I recently downloaded Eclipse 4.7 (Oxygen) and Java 11.0.2. The installer worked fine, however, when I try to open Eclipse it shows the graphic for the app, asks the folder I would like to make my workspace, then immediately crashes. I have tried deleting and redownloading everything but it still happens. In the log it says java.lang.NoClassDefFoundError. I though maybe this meant I had a path error, so I went into eclipse.ini and specified the -vm to go to javaw.exe but it sill does not work.

APIs that were merely deprecated from Java 9 were outright removed from Java 11. You will need a newer release of Eclipse.

4.7 is also from 2017. The 4.20 release was a few days ago, and what you should be using instead.
